**Q: Why did last week's catalogue import into Shelfwright drop records?**

A: The import job rejects any MARC-like record missing a normalized title field, and the upstream feed from the Harrowgate branch changed its delimiter, so roughly 4% of rows failed parsing. The records were quarantined, not lost — they sit in the retry bucket and can be reprocessed once the delimiter mapping is patched. For the sync, please review the quarantine counts and the remapping procedure documented on the internal page below.

dashboard of yahaf-kajep = https://jira.zemvarsys.internal/display/projects/browse/browse/a08b

## Approvals: Data-Retention Sweeper

The Hollowell retention sweeper permanently deletes records past their policy window, so every configuration change requires written approval before deployment. Contractors: never adjust retention intervals, table scopes, or the dry-run flag without sign-off, even in staging. Submit proposed changes with a diff and an affected-record estimate. Review typically takes two business days. Final approval authority for all sweeper changes rests with one person.

named custodian: Brivan Eliath Quenox Frador

Q: The Vanterra elevator-dispatch simulator is producing starved hall calls on the upper floors — what should I check first? A: Starvation usually means the bank-assignment weights drifted after a config reload, not a scheduler bug. Confirm the active policy version, replay the last ten minutes of call traffic in sandbox mode, and compare dispatch latencies against baseline. The diagnostic walkthrough is on the page below.

runbook for tafof-yawif: https://confluence.tolvaqsys.internal/display/display/browse/pages/7be3

Ticket: Config drift on the Pulsewren telemetry collectors. Staging compresses payloads with zstd while prod still ships them raw, which inflates bandwidth and skews our latency dashboards. New folks: this happens when someone patches a node by hand instead of updating the template. The settings below are what production should converge to.

deployment values, kajep-kageg:
[praix]
host = praix.paliqcorp.corp
user = praix_svc
database = praix_prod